Java FullStack Developer Specialization Board Infinity

Many Java programs use SQL (Structured Query Language) when building and using databases. Ideally, you should also familiarize yourself with Oracle 12c, Microsoft SQL, and MySQL database systems. As a, you work closely with your business’s development team.

java developer

Alternatively, JavaScript is an interpreted scripting language, meaning it’s translated into machine code when it’s run. Get practical advice from senior developers to navigate your current dev challenges. Discover transformative insights to level up your software development decisions. The Oracle Java Universal SE Subscription is a pay-as-you-go offering that provides customers with best-in-class support.

Java Polymorphism

Entry-level developers or interns work as trainees at these tech companies. Interns must know how to use the tools and libraries they chose to work with. These people should have a strong theoretical background and know the basics of practical programming. This specialization will guide you from the basics of Java programming to developing complex front-end web applications using Angular and robust backend systems using Spring and Spring Boot. You will learn to design, develop, and integrate various parts of a web application. The size of the business you work in may influence your daily tasks.

With years of experience as a java developer, the compensation sees a fruitful increase. As an experienced developer, you not only get a higher payout but an opportunity as a product and a team lead. After getting a hang of the basics, you can try learning Java EE (Enterprise Edition) aka advanced java. Helidon is a cloud-native, open-source set of Java libraries for writing microservices that run on a fast web core powered by Java virtual threads. Board Infinity is a full-stack career platform, founded in 2017 that bridges the gap between career aspirants and industry experts. Our platform fosters professional growth, delivering personalized learning experiences, expert career coaching, and diverse opportunities to help individuals fulfill their career dreams.

Earn a career certificate

Embark on a journey to master Java, one of the most versatile and widely-used programming languages, with our comprehensive Java courses. Created by top universities and industry leaders, our curriculum caters to a range of learners, from beginners to advanced programmers. Whether you’re looking to build robust applications, delve into software engineering, or understand back-end technologies, our courses are designed to equip you with the skills and knowledge required. You’ll gain practical experience through a blend of theoretical learning and hands-on projects, preparing you to tackle real-world programming challenges with Java. These courses are perfect for anyone aspiring to become a proficient Java developer, enhance existing coding skills, or explore the vast possibilities of Java in various tech domains. Join our community and start your journey toward becoming an expert in Java programming.

java developer

If you work in a large business or busy industry, you may need to manage multiple updates simultaneously. If you are an experienced developer, you will need to understand your business’s programs, IT infrastructure, and program architecture in-depth. Understanding program architecture is crucial, as it’ll inform how you develop new projects.

What is Java Developer?

As Java development requires a lot of technical knowledge and expertise, the best developers are always learning. When hiring a developer, look for someone who can continue to grow their skills on the job. Since Java’s release in 1995, many modern programming languages have descended from it, including Python, Scala, JavaScript, and PHP. Naturally, Java has remained one of the most popular programming languages to learn. The median salary for Indian-based how to become a java developers is over Rs. 4.5 LPA and goes up depending on career level, experience, and location. These facts make the role of a java developer a lucrative one with long-term benefits.

This helps IT organizations manage complexity, contain costs, and mitigate security risks. GraalVM for JDK 21 will receive updates under the GFTC, until September 2026, a year after the release of the next LTS. JDK 21 will receive updates under the NFTC, until September 2026, a year after the release of the next LTS.

What makes the Java Full Stack Developer specialization so unique?

This license permits certain
uses, such as personal use and development use, at no cost — but other uses authorized under prior Oracle JDK
licenses may no longer be available. Please review the terms carefully before downloading and using this product. Also available for development, personal use, and to run other licensed Oracle products. It is not difficult to learn Java on your own; there are numerous resources available for self-study and practice. There are many websites that will provide you hands-on experience and teach you how to program in Java, regardless of your age or experience level.

  • The United States Bureau of Labor Statistics estimates there are more than 1,469,000 software developers around the country.
  • The Object-Oriented Programming methodology introduces the principles of inheritance, encapsulation, abstraction, and polymorphism through the use of classes and objects.
  • There are many websites that will provide you hands-on experience and teach you how to program in Java, regardless of your age or experience level.
  • GraalVM for JDK 21 without the Native Image feature included is available for customers at My Oracle Support.
  • You may use this code in a new project, ongoing updates for an existing project, or bug fixes.

There is an eclectic amount of java developer skills, from a thorough understanding of the basics to adapting to the latest developments. Java developers also need knowledge beyond the language itself, including how the development process works and how to navigate the environments in which the code runs. Java is one of the most widely used programming languages in the world. Talking about its popularity, more than nine million developers considered the Java Programming language as their mother tongue. Java is a general-purpose, object-oriented programming language that first appeared in 1995. Despite being released over 25 years ago, Java maintains its position among the top 3 programming languages according to the TIOBE Index for February 2022.